The organism is seasonal, encountered only during the respiratory disease season. The majority of patients with pneumonia (80% to 90%) have underlying chronic pulmonary disease, and their clinical illness may be difficult to distinguish from exacerbations of lung disease by other causes.

In addition, M. catarrhalis can cause nosocomial pneumonia with evidence of patient-to-patient spread of the organism. M. catarrhalis is a common cause of otitis media in young children. Microbiologic studies indicate that this organism is present in approximately 15% of the aspirates from such patients.

High fever, pleuritic pain, and toxic states are uncommon, as are empyema and bacteremia (108, 182, 192, 218, 252). 2021-03-22 · M catarrhalis LRTI is also associated with smoking. M catarrhalis is isolated from sputum and transtracheal aspirate specimens at rates of 0.2-8.1%, accompanied by H influenzae and/or S pneumoniae in more than 30% of cases.
